What Is Platelet-Rich Plasma Therapy, and What Are the Benefits of It?

Platelet-rich plasma therapy is a cutting-edge cosmetic procedure that utilizes the healing properties of a patient’s blood to promote facial rejuvenation and skin regeneration. PRP is rich in growth factors that play a crucial role in tissue repair and cell renewal.

Because of this, it is highly beneficial and effective at treating acne scars, deep creases, rough or uneven skin tone and texture, sagging skin, and wrinkles, particularly when injected into the skin or even applied topically after microneedling.

How Long Does It Take to See Improvement After Injections?

It really varies, and change doesn’t happen overnight. Some patients notice subtle improvements in skin texture and tone within a few weeks, but the most significant changes gradually become visible over the course of several months.

This is because it works by stimulating the body’s natural healing process and collagen production, which takes time.

How Long Does PRP Really Last? Are Results Permanent?

Platelet-rich plasma therapy can permanently enhance the quality of your skin, however the longevity of results depends on factors such as your age, overall health, and skincare routine. While it can provide impressive and long-lasting results, it is ultimately not a permanent solution.

PRP lasts anywhere from 12 to 18 months, though it may last longer. To maintain the benefits, opt for occasional PRP touch-up sessions after the initial results start to fade. Adopting a healthy lifestyle, wearing sunscreen, and using quality skincare products helps as well.
